Is Amazon Keeping The Inflation Rate Low?

Published Wednesday, October 31, 2018 at: 7:00 AM EDT

Amazon's 2017 annual 10(K) federal financial filing reported $4.1 billion in net operating income. But the profit was entirely attributable to Amazon's tech infrastructure line of business, Amazon Web Services (AWS). Amazon's retail sales business reported a loss.Unless you're a professional securities analyst or MBA, it may not be easy to discern that Amazon lost money on its main business from the company's required 10(K) annual public disclosure filing with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ission.
